home / openregs

congress_members

All current and historical members of Congress (12,700+) from the congress-legislators project. Includes bioguide_id (universal key), party, state, chamber, and cross-reference IDs for OpenSecrets, FEC, GovTrack, and more.

Data license: Public Domain (U.S. Government data) · Data source: Federal Register API & Regulations.gov API

24 rows where chamber = "Senate", party = "Democrat" and state = "MD" sorted by full_name

✎ View and edit SQL

This data as json, CSV (advanced)

Suggested facets: first_name, last_name, first_served, opensecrets_id, fec_ids, thomas_id, ballotpedia_id, gender, terms_count, trade_count, speech_count, bills_sponsored, vote_count, fec_total_received, first_served (date), last_served (date), birthday (date), served_until (date), fec_ids (array)

is_current 2

  • 0 22
  • 1 2

state 1

  • MD · 24 ✖

party 1

  • Democrat · 24 ✖

chamber 1

  • Senate · 24 ✖
bioguide_id first_name last_name full_name ▼ nickname party state chamber district first_served last_served is_current opensecrets_id fec_ids govtrack_id thomas_id votesmart_id lis_id wikipedia_id ballotpedia_id birthday gender terms_count served_until trade_count speech_count bills_sponsored vote_count fec_total_received
A000382 Angela Alsobrooks Angela D. Alsobrooks   Democrat MD Senate   2025-01-03 2031-01-03 1 N00053033 ["S4MD00327"] 456965     S428 Angela Alsobrooks   1971-02-23 F 2   0 50 23 705 34339278
G000326 Arthur Gorman Arthur Gorman   Democrat MD Senate   1881-12-05 1907-03-03 0   [] 404684       Arthur P. Gorman   1839-03-11 M 5 1907-03-03 0 0 0 0 0
M000702 Barbara Mikulski Barbara A. Mikulski   Democrat MD Senate   1977-01-04 2017-01-03 0 N00001945 ["S6MD00140"] 300073 00802 53304 S182 Barbara Mikulski Barbara Mikulski 1936-07-20 F 7 2017-01-03 0 1793 404 5623 2169651
C000141 Benjamin Cardin Benjamin L. Cardin   Democrat MD Senate   1987-01-06 2025-01-03 0 N00001955 ["H6MD03177", "S6MD03177"] 400064 00174 26888 S308 Ben Cardin Ben Cardin 1943-10-05 M 7 2025-01-03 15 3753 769 8385 4872450
L000189 Blair Lee Blair Lee   Democrat MD Senate   1914-01-28 1917-03-03 0   [] 406692       Blair Lee I   1857-08-09 M 1 1917-03-03 0 0 0 0 0
G000157 Charles Gibson Charles Gibson   Democrat MD Senate   1885-12-07 1897-03-03 0   [] 404524       Charles H. Gibson   1842-01-19 M 3 1897-03-03 0 0 0 0 0
V000128 Chris Van Hollen Chris Van Hollen   Democrat MD Senate   2003-01-07 2029-01-03 1 N00013820 ["H2MD08126", "S6MD03441"] 400415 01729 6098 S390 Chris Van Hollen Chris Van Hollen 1959-01-10 M 5   7 2095 360 13682 7322942
B000813 Daniel Brewster Daniel Brewster   Democrat MD Senate   1959-01-07 1969-01-03 0   [] 401770       Daniel Brewster   1923-11-23 M 2 1969-01-03 0 0 0 0 0
W000577 Ephraim Wilson Ephraim Wilson   Democrat MD Senate   1873-12-01 1891-03-03 0   [] 411732       Ephraim K. Wilson II   1821-12-22 M 4 1891-03-03 0 0 0 0 0
D000242 George Dennis George Dennis   Democrat MD Senate   1873-12-01 1879-03-03 0   [] 403380       George R. Dennis   1822-04-08 M 2 1879-03-03 0 0 0 0 0
R000006 George Radcliffe George Radcliffe   Democrat MD Senate   1935-01-03 1947-01-03 0   [] 408989       George L. P. Radcliffe   1877-08-22 M 3 1947-01-03 0 0 0 0 0
V000095 George Vickers George Vickers   Democrat MD Senate   1868-01-01 1873-03-03 0   [] 411150       George Vickers   1801-11-19 M 1 1873-03-03 0 0 0 0 0
O000032 Herbert O’Conor Herbert O’Conor   Democrat MD Senate   1947-01-03 1953-01-03 0   [] 408280       Herbert O'Conor   1896-11-17 M 2 1953-01-03 0 0 0 0 0
R000086 Isidor Rayner Isidor Rayner   Democrat MD Senate   1887-12-05 1913-03-03 0   [] 409066       Isidor Rayner   1850-04-11 M 5 1913-03-03 0 0 0 0 0
G000492 James Groome James Groome   Democrat MD Senate   1879-03-18 1885-03-03 0   [] 404837       James Black Groome   1838-04-04 M 2 1885-03-03 0 0 0 0 0
P000161 James Pearce James Pearce   Democrat MD Senate   1835-12-07 1863-03-03 0   [] 408566       James Pearce   1805-12-14 M 5 1863-03-03 0 0 0 0 0
S000577 John Smith John Smith   Democrat MD Senate   1899-12-04 1921-03-03 0   [] 410058       John Walter Smith   1845-02-05 M 4 1921-03-03 0 0 0 0 0
T000445 Joseph Tydings Joseph Tydings   Democrat MD Senate   1965-01-04 1971-01-03 0   [] 411013       Joseph Tydings   1928-05-04 M 2 1971-01-03 0 0 0 0 0
T000446 Millard Tydings Millard Tydings   Democrat MD Senate   1923-12-03 1951-01-03 0   [] 411014       Millard Tydings   1890-04-06 M 5 1951-01-03 0 0 0 0 0
S000064 Paul Sarbanes Paul Sarbanes   Democrat MD Senate   1971-01-21 2007-01-03 0 N00001979 ["S6MD00066"] 300086 01017   S106 Paul Sarbanes   1933-02-03 M 7 2007-01-03 0 1159 213 2625 0
J000169 Reverdy Johnson Reverdy Johnson   Democrat MD Senate   1845-12-01 1869-03-03 0   [] 406066       Reverdy Johnson   1796-05-21 M 5 1869-03-03 0 0 0 0 0
B000972 William Bruce William Bruce   Democrat MD Senate   1923-12-03 1929-03-03 0   [] 401924       William Cabell Bruce   1860-03-12 M 2 1929-03-03 0 0 0 0 0
H000118 William Hamilton William Hamilton   Democrat MD Senate   1849-12-03 1875-03-03 0   [] 405000       William T. Hamilton   1820-09-08 M 5 1875-03-03 0 0 0 0 0
W000435 William Whyte William Whyte   Democrat MD Senate   1868-01-01 1908-03-17 0   [] 411594       William Pinkney Whyte   1824-08-09 M 7 1908-03-17 0 0 0 0 0

Advanced export

JSON shape: default, array, newline-delimited, object

CSV options:

CREATE TABLE congress_members (
    bioguide_id TEXT PRIMARY KEY,
    first_name TEXT,
    last_name TEXT,
    full_name TEXT,
    nickname TEXT,
    party TEXT,
    state TEXT,
    chamber TEXT,
    district INTEGER,
    first_served TEXT,
    last_served TEXT,
    is_current INTEGER,
    opensecrets_id TEXT,
    fec_ids TEXT,
    govtrack_id INTEGER,
    thomas_id TEXT,
    votesmart_id INTEGER,
    lis_id TEXT,
    wikipedia_id TEXT,
    ballotpedia_id TEXT,
    birthday TEXT,
    gender TEXT,
    terms_count INTEGER,
    served_until TEXT
, trade_count INTEGER DEFAULT 0, speech_count INTEGER DEFAULT 0, bills_sponsored INTEGER DEFAULT 0, vote_count INTEGER DEFAULT 0, fec_total_received INTEGER DEFAULT 0);
CREATE INDEX idx_cm_name ON congress_members(last_name, first_name);
CREATE INDEX idx_cm_party ON congress_members(party);
CREATE INDEX idx_cm_state ON congress_members(state);
CREATE INDEX idx_cm_chamber ON congress_members(chamber);
CREATE INDEX idx_cm_current ON congress_members(is_current);
CREATE INDEX idx_cm_current_trades ON congress_members(is_current DESC, trade_count DESC);
Powered by Datasette · Queries took 87.696ms · Data license: Public Domain (U.S. Government data) · Data source: Federal Register API & Regulations.gov API